在开发的过程中,我们很多时候会遇到需要将两个数组合并成一个数组的情况出现。 var arr1 = [1, 2, 3];
var arr2 = [4, 5, 6];
// 将arr1和arr2合并成为[1, 2, 3, 4, 5, 6] 这里总结一下在JavaScript中合并两个数组的方法。for循环数组这个方式是最简单的,也是最容易实现的。 var arr3 = [];
// 遍历ar
var arr1=[1,2,3,4,5,6,7,8,9,10,0],arr2=[7,0,6,5,2]; function filterArr(allArr,selecArr){ var midArr = arr1; for(var item of arr2){ midArr = midArr.fil
原创
2022-08-04 15:57:52
143阅读
# Java中两个数组中不重复元素的处理方法
在Java编程中,有时候我们需要处理两个数组中的不重复元素,即找出两个数组中各自独有的元素。本文将介绍如何使用Java代码实现这一功能,并提供代码示例。
## 问题描述
假设我们有两个数组A和B,它们分别包含一些元素。我们希望找出在数组A中出现而在数组B中没有出现的元素,以及在数组B中出现而在数组A中没有出现的元素。
## 解决方法
一种简单
就是找到仅在两个数组中出现过一次的数据 最终出来的结果是 [2,3,8], 原理其实很简单: 合并两个数组,然后查找数组的第一个出现的索引和最后...
转载
2022-04-18 14:43:26
622阅读
# Python实现不重复的两个数
## 概述
在Python中实现不重复的两个数可以通过多种方式,本文将介绍一种简单而高效的方法。通过这个例子,你将学会如何使用Python编程语言来解决这个问题。
## 流程
为了实现不重复的两个数,我们可以按照以下步骤进行操作:
| 步骤 | 描述 |
| ---- | ---- |
| 1. | 创建一个空的列表 |
| 2. | 遍历给定
1.考虑不重复元素,重复元素不添加 2.重复元素添加
原创
2022-08-05 23:06:16
97阅读
本组囊括数组相关题目,难度不等:27.Remove Element题目描述:简单 注意不能使用额外空间。解法一:拷贝覆盖:,其实这也是双指针中的快慢指针思想。 可以想到的是,我们设置一个新的数组下标ans初始为0,遍历原来的数组,当数组中的值等于val值时,则跳过该数字;当不等时,则拷贝并覆盖这个数字到新的数组并ans自增1,最后返回ans则能得到结果。时间复杂度:O(n
# Java数组去重:一个初学者的指南
作为一名初学者,你可能会遇到需要比较两个数组并去除重复元素的情况。本文将通过一个简单的示例,教你如何使用Java来实现这一功能。
## 流程概述
首先,让我们通过一个表格来概述整个流程:
| 步骤 | 描述 |
|------|------
## 两个数组是否有元素重复的判断
作为一名经验丰富的开发者,你需要教会一位刚入行的小白如何实现“两个数组是否有元素重复”的判断。本文将以Java语言为例,详细讲解实现的流程和每一步所需要的代码。
### 流程图
首先,我们可以使用流程图来展示整个判断过程。以下是一个简单的流程图,展示了判断两个数组是否有元素重复的流程。
```mermaid
flowchart TD
S(开始)
# Python中删除两个数组重复元素的技巧
在编程中,尤其是在数据处理和分析时,去除重复数据是一项常见且重要的任务。在Python中,我们可以利用多种方法来删除数组中的重复元素。本文将介绍如何删除两个数组中重复的元素,并演示一些代码示例,帮助读者理解这个过程。
## 1. 理解问题
假设我们有两个数组,如下所示:
```python
array1 = [1, 2, 3, 4, 5]
ar
# Python查看数组不重复元素的个数
在Python中,我们经常需要对数组中的元素进行处理和分析。其中一个常见的需求是查看数组中不重复元素的个数。这在数据分析、统计学和机器学习等领域中经常会遇到。在本文中,我们将介绍如何使用Python来实现这一功能。
## 方法一:使用集合(Set)
在Python中,集合是一种无序且元素唯一的数据结构。我们可以利用集合的特性来快速去除数组中的重复元素
方法一:>>> mylist = [1,2,2,2,2,3,3,3,4,4,4,4]>>> myset = set(mylist)>>> for item in myset: print("the %d has found %d" %(it
转载
2023-05-25 14:20:02
136阅读
## Java快速随机两个数不重复
在Java编程中,我们经常需要生成随机数。有时候我们需要生成两个不重复的随机数来处理某些特定的需求。本文将介绍如何在Java中快速生成两个不重复的随机数,并给出相应的代码示例。
### 为什么需要快速生成不重复的随机数?
在某些情况下,我们需要生成两个不重复的随机数,例如在游戏中生成随机的敌人位置,或者生成随机的抽奖结果等。生成不重复的随机数有以下几个原因
# jQuery获取数组元素个数
在Web开发中,经常会遇到需要对数组进行操作的情况。而对于一个数组,有时我们需要知道其中包含多少个元素。在jQuery中,我们可以使用一些方法来获取数组元素的个数。
## 使用length属性
在jQuery中,每个jQuery对象都具有一个名为`length`的属性,它代表了该对象中包含的元素个数。如果我们有一个数组,可以将其转换为jQuery对象,然后通
//这是用第三种方式调用的
import java.util.Arrays;
public class Day09Task01 {
public static void main(String[] args) {
int[] arr = {4, 6, 7};
int[] arr2 = {34, 67, 98, 3};
int[] newAr
转载
2022-09-25 11:07:33
204阅读
双循环去重——双重for(或while)循环是比较笨拙的方法,它实现的原理很简单:先定义一个包含原始数组第一个元素的数组,然后遍历原始数组,将原始数组中的每个元素与新数组中的每个元素进行比对,如果不重复则添加到新数组中,最后返回新数组;因为它的时间复杂度是O(n^2),如果数组长度很大,那么将会非常耗费内存indexOf方法去重1——数组的indexOf()方法可返回某个指定的元素在数组中首次出现
管理选择器所得到的结果用jQuery选择出来的元素与数组非常类似,可以通过jQuery提供的一系列方法对其进行处理。包括获取长度,查找某个元素、筛选元素、遍历每个元素等。size()获取选择器中元素的个数,类似数组中的lengthindex(element)查找元素在集合中的位置add()给集合添加元素not()去除元素集合中的某个元素filter()筛选元素集合中的元素find()通过查询获取新
# 如何使用jQuery判断两个数组是否相同
## 一、整体流程
```mermaid
journey
title 判断两个数组是否相同的流程
section 开始
开发者 -> 小白: 问候,了解问题
section 实施过程
开发者 -> 小白: 介绍判断两个数组方法
小白 -> 开发者: 学习并实践
sect
/* (程序头部注释开始)
* 程序的版权和版本声明部分
* Copyright (c) 2011, 烟台大学计算机学院学生
* All rights reserved.
* 文件名称:求矩阵元素相乘
* 算法提示:(1)用二维数组表示矩阵,实现矩阵乘法。
* 算法提示:(2)如C=A*B,要考虑矩阵相乘的规则,即A矩阵和B矩阵是任意的,
* 算法提示:(3)C矩阵的产
转载
2023-07-22 07:46:30
107阅读
本文属于面试题整理系列:给出2个数组,要求查出相同的元素 题目描述有些歧义,我对此理解就是相同元素就是两个数组都有的,而不是单个数组有的。就是下面写个demo测试下 public static Set<Integer> findSameElementIn2Arrays(Integer[] array1,Integer[] array2) {
Set<Integer